Out of 8 sailors on a boat, 3 can work only on one particular side and 2 only on the other side. Find the number of ways in which the ways in which the sailors can be arranged on the boat.

Correct Answer - 1728
Let the particular side on which 3 particular sailors can work be named A, and another side B on which 2 particular sailors can work. Thus, we are left with 3 sailors only.
The number of ways of selection of one sailor for side A is `.^(3)C_(1)=3` and then we are left with 2 sailors for other sides. Now, on each side 4 sailors can be arranged in 4! ways. Hence, total number of arrangements is `3xx4!xx4!=3xx24xx24=1728`.
